The Uncommon Wife

35m · Published 20 Mar 16:46

If you want to have an uncommon marriage, you need to be an uncommon wife.

While most people think marriage solves problems, more often than not it will require you to confront your heart, character, and behavior. Whether you are a young couple or have been married for some time, dealing with your spouse will always pose a challenge.

I know for me, the beginning of my marriage forced me to take a look in the mirror and do a self-evaluation. Trust me, it was not pretty. Without knowing it, many times we come to marriage with baggage that has not been dealt with.

For those who are not yet at this stage, singlehood is the perfect opportunity to prepare to be the best wife you can be for your husband and get ahead in maturity, understanding and personal liberty.

I can only imagine how much pain I could have been saved from if I had just taken the time to focus on the state of my soul before entering marriage.

This painful process showed me what I was doing wrong and what I needed to do to make a complete turnaround and have the marriage God destined for me to enjoy.

Marriage is one of the most important ministries to God for a reason. There is a power and a purpose for your marriage, you just need to discover it! You can have a blissful, loving and God-centered marriage.

The key is your mindset. I am going to let you in on the intimate struggles of my marriage. You and your spouse are made for greatness, do you believe it?

3 Keys to Being an Uncommon Wife:

  1. [13:38] Heal internally. Most of the time, the issues that trigger us most in marriage are directly related to issues in our past that were never fully dealt with.

  2. [18:09] Get an uncommon revelation of who you are and who your husband is. The word says your value is compared to rubies. That means you are priceless and special. You need to change how you see yourself first and realize who your husband is, beyond what you may see now.

  3. [24:45] Realize that you need uncommon humility. This is necessary to take down your defensive walls and pride. Walls are meant to separate. This cannot be present in restoring and getting ready for an uncommon marriage.

Episode 6: How to Heal from Mother Wounds

42m · Published 26 Feb 21:30

Back in another episode, we are talking about mother wounds. Wounds can run deep and unseen. They have aftereffects, trauma, and pain. A mother is one of the most important figures in your life, which is why wounds in this area hurt the most.

No matter how tumultuous your relationship, the wounds between a mother and child can be restored. You may think your case is the exception, but that’s not true.

Even with all the hurt, the good news is that wounds can be healed! Here, I take you through my story of the relationship I had with my mother before she passed away. Trust me, it was not cute mom and daughter lunch dates. I went through my own personal journey of internal healing and restoration. The key point to remember here is that no mother is perfect.

Let me help teach you how to get on the road to healing, freedom and joy. I am going to take my mask off, in hopes that you are encouraged to do the same.

Healing Mother Wounds:

  1. [6:25] Go back to the place of pain. The root of all your pain and trauma cannot be dealt with until you confront the memories and origins of where it all began. The first step is always the one people want to skip, when it in fact is the step that will ensure your healing.

  2. [7:15] Forgive yourself for making mistakes. Just as there is no perfect mother, there is no perfect daughter. Consider how your own actions or behavior may have added unto strains in your mother-daughter relationship. After this, recognize, learn, rectify and grow from those mistakes!

  3. [12:10] Apologize. Mothers and daughters. You could be one apology away from restoring your relationship! Do not allow pride to get in the way of restoration.

  4. [26:53] Admit that you needed a mother and maybe still do. If you have gone a long time without the active positive presence of your mother, you may tell yourself that you do not need her. That your life is perfectly fine without her. Deep in your heart you need to acknowledge that this is not true. Every mother has something to offer you. Find those pearls and extract what you can.

  5. [34:25] Do not be consumed with what your mother is not. Instead remember what she is. Maybe your mother is not affectionate, but she taught you how to cook and clean. You might not have had the bonding experience of baking together, but because of her wisdom in the kitchen, you know to cook delicious meals. Focus on all the good.

Episode 5: How to Heal from Father Wounds

27m · Published 19 Feb 17:10

There is a kind of pain that exists which cannot be seen on the surface but can still be felt deeply.

Sometimes wounds aren’t as obvious as people think. Unseen pain will always be more hurtful and damaging than the pain that is obvious because unseen pain cannot be easily diagnosed. It is only until you go deeper, that you discover where the true pain is coming from.

Today I am talking about father wounds. The lack of a father figure in your life will affect you in ways you may not even consider. You may think your lonely or angry behavior is just a part of your personality when in reality, it could be directly connected to the father wounds you carry deep inside you.

Fathers bring safety, identity, and affirmation. The lack of a father brings forth loneliness, fear, paranoia, and insecurity. It will make you want attention from anyone. Even more, if you feel bitterness or unforgiveness towards your father, you are still carrying pain.

This is not a type of pain which time heals. Ignoring it will not help.

Can I humbly offer a solution to you? God, as the best Father, can heal you. He is a Father that has always loved you unconditionally and will never wish any evil towards you. The only action needed is to receive his love. However, to do so restoration is necessary.
Why? Because of the lack of a biological father makes it hard to receive your spiritual Father.

If you do not deal with your father wounds, you will continue to be bound by the pain this wound causes and fear is not the will of God for your life! He wants you to live in peace. He wants you to have a whole, healed heart. A joyful spirit.

This process is not easy, but if you allow God to do a work inside of your heart, I know you will begin to walk a life of liberty.

Here are the steps I took in healing that I hope help you as well.

[4:50] Open up to the place of pain. Wounds do not go away and heal by just ignoring it. You have to look at the place of pain, no matter how ugly, and face it head-on.

[14:43] Be delivered. This calls for deliverance from fear. More importantly, a spirit most people do not realize hides behind fear. Rejection.

[18:05] Receive the spirit of adoption. Receiving the love of the Father means you will receive all that your natural father has been unable to provide. This does not mean that your natural father does not have something to offer you of value.

[20:17] Know that God is the best Father. He can restore all the damage that not having the biological father that you need has done to you. Release the pain and receive His love and goodness.
